Comprehensive Support and Structure
The program incorporates multiple layers of structure and support, ensuring residents meet specific criteria as they progress. This system is designed to ease communication and provide continuous encouragement from peers and professional staff. Key components of the structured environment include:
- Mandatory weekly sobriety program meetings.
- Engagement with a sobriety program sponsor.
- Strict adherence to random drug testing protocols.
- Participation in regular house meetings facilitated by management.
In addition to sober living housing, clients may access a variety of addiction treatment services provided by Sober Living Properties, which can range from residential inpatient and detoxification services to flexible intensive outpatient (IOP) and regular outpatient programming. Counseling, including individual, group, family, and couples counseling, is a core component used to address the underlying causes of addiction and develop effective recovery tools.

Frequently Asked Questions
What makes Sober Living Properties different from standard rehab facilities?
Sober Living Properties specializes in transitional housing, providing a necessary, stable, drug and alcohol-free bridge between intensive clinical treatment and independent living. While they offer clinical treatment components like detox and outpatient programs, their primary focus is on long-term community support and structured living after initial rehabilitation.
Is this facility licensed?
Yes, Sober Living Properties is fully licensed through the Department of Human Services and holds Justice Reform Initiative certification, ensuring compliance with professional standards for health and safety.
